This seems interesting: Two Jan 6 figures, a planner and a rally organizer, tell a Rolling Stone reporter that Rep Gosar told them he had spoken with Donald Trump and he promised a blanket pardon for all the insurectionists. They further claim they were in meetings with : M T Greene. "Along with Greene, the conspiratorial pro-Trump Republican from Georgia who took office earlier this year, the pair both say the members who participated in these conversations or had top staffers join in included Rep. Paul Gosar (R-Ariz.), Rep. Lauren Boebert (R-Colo.), Rep. Mo Brooks (R-Ala.), Rep. Madison Cawthorn (R-N.C.), Rep. Andy Biggs (R-Ariz.), and Rep. Louie Gohmert (R-Texas)." A third informant met with Chief of Staff Mark Meadows. This info has already been communicated to the Commision. The article says the three met with the reporter over a period of weeks and say they attended "dozens" of meetings with the people listed above.
